WebApr 12, 2024 · Well, to write greater than or equal to in Python, you need to use the >= comparison operator. It will return a Boolean value – either True or False. The "greater than or equal to" operator is known as a comparison operator. These operators compare numbers or strings and return a value of either True or False. WebJan 10, 2024 · In Excel, you can use the >= operator to check if a value in a given cell is greater than or equal to some value.
